**1. Understanding the Landscape**
The first step to quintessential property management is understanding the country’s landscape and locale-specific demands. Sri Lanka, fondly known as the Pearl of the Indian Ocean, experiences steady tourism influx; however, these guests have varied needs. Once you translate the demands, such as proximity to tea gardens in the Nuwara Eliya district or beachfront properties in Galle, into your property’s unique selling points, you will be a step closer to a successful Airbnb listing.
**2. Focus on Aesthetics**
Airbnb guests often sway towards homes with striking aesthetics that offer a refreshing break from monotony. Take your property’s vibe a notch higher by incorporating local motifs. You could opt for handloom fabric from Galle to dress your interiors or adorn the rooms with typical Sri Lankan masks. A brilliant blend of modern amenities and exotic, local accents can enhance your listing’s appeal, carving a memorable experience for guests.
**3. Provide Unforgettable Experiences**
Let your Airbnb listing stand out by offering unforgettable experiences. For instance, a cooking class featuring local cuisine, or a guided tour to the nearby tea plantation, jungle trekking, or even arranging an interactive session with endemic wildlife can go a long way. Making your guests delve into the Sri Lankan culture will undoubtedly leave an indelible impression and ensure excellent reviews and recommendations.
**4. Ensuring Guest Comfort**
In property management, comfort is king! Strive to provide amenities like fast Wi-Fi, clean linens, fully-equipped kitchens, and comprehensive guides about the property and neighborhood. An emergency contact list including numbers for local doctors, taxi services, and 24/7 property management support is the cherry on top. This will not only offer peace of mind to your guests but also place your property as a top choice for other potential visitors.
**5. Regular Maintenance & Upkeep**
A well-maintained property is wildly attractive, and this simply cannot be overstated. Make sure your property is inspected and cleaned after each visit, with minor issues fixed promptly. If you are away, hiring a local property management company could save you a lot of trouble. Remember, each guest should feel like the first one stepping into your Airbnb listing.
**6. Communicate, Communicate, Communicate!**
Communication is a cornerstone in Airbnb property management. Swiftly respond to inquiries, requests, and messages, while being proactive in requesting feedback. Engage your guests and make them feel welcome even before they’ve stepped onto your property. An attentive and responsive host makes a world of difference in the guest’s experience and overall rating.
**7. Stay Legal**
Booking platforms like Airbnb have caught the attention of many regulators worldwide. Ensure that you fully understand the local laws, by-laws, taxation, and insurance factors that apply to short-term rentals in Sri Lanka. This will help you stay atop the legal aspect and save you from any potential hiccups down the road. Hiring a knowledgeable local expert can also ease this process.
